"This passage was explored by Dr. Robinson, Sir Charles Wilson, Sir Charles Warren, and Other folks; though the inscription on the rock close to the mouth in the tunnel was not witnessed, staying then below drinking water. When it had been present in 1880 by a boy who entered from your Siloam conclude with the passage, it absolutely was Just about obliterated via the deposit of lime crystals on the letters. Professor Sayce, then in Palestine, produced a duplicate, and was capable of finding out the overall that means on the letters. In 1881 Dr. Guthe cleaned the textual content which has a weak acid Alternative, and I had been then ready, While using the support of Lieutenant Mentell, R.

That it absolutely was so sealed We all know from two Chron 32:three-four. The next account with the channel and its inscription is from Big C. R. Conder (Palestine, pp. 27 ff.). "The class in the channel is serpentine, as well as the farther stop near the pool of Siloam enlarges into a passage of substantial height. Down this channel the waters of the spring hurry into the pool Any time the unexpected stream takes place. In autumn there is an interval of several times; in Winter season the sudden movement requires place sometimes 2 times daily. A pure click here siphon from an underground basin accounts for this move, as also for that with the 'Sabbatic river' in North Syria. When it happens the narrow parts of the passage are loaded on the roof with water.

The pool of Siloam is fed by a conduit that is certainly Slice for just a length of one,780 toes as a result of good rock, and which starts off at the so-known as Virgin's Spring (see En-rogel). The main reason for which it was Slice is unmistakable. The Virgin's Spring is the one spring of contemporary drinking water while in the rapid community of Jerusalem, and in time of siege it was essential that, whilst the enemy ought to be deprived of access to it, its waters should be made available for those who were throughout the town. Even so the spring rose outdoors the walls, over the sloping cliff that overlooks the valley of Kidron. Appropriately, an extended passage was excavated within the rock, by means of which the overflow of your spring was introduced into Jerusalem; the spring by itself was lined with masonry, making sure that it could be "sealed" in the event of war.
